博客 "AI分析技术:核心算法与实现方法解析"

"AI分析技术:核心算法与实现方法解析"

   数栈君   发表于 2026-03-18 14:05  46  0

AI分析技术:核心算法与实现方法解析

在数字化转型的浪潮中,AI分析技术正成为企业提升竞争力的关键武器。通过AI分析技术,企业能够从海量数据中提取有价值的信息,优化决策流程,提升运营效率。本文将深入解析AI分析技术的核心算法与实现方法,帮助企业更好地理解和应用这一技术。


一、AI分析技术的核心算法

AI分析技术的核心在于算法,这些算法能够从数据中提取模式、关系和洞察。以下是几种常见的AI分析算法及其应用场景:

1. 机器学习算法

机器学习是AI分析的基础,通过训练模型从数据中学习规律,并用于预测或分类。

  • 监督学习:通过标记数据训练模型,例如分类任务(如垃圾邮件识别)和回归任务(如房价预测)。
  • 无监督学习:在无标记数据中发现隐藏模式,例如聚类(如客户分群)和降维(如PCA)。
  • 强化学习:通过与环境交互学习最优策略,例如游戏AI和机器人控制。

2. 深度学习算法

深度学习是机器学习的子集,通过多层神经网络模拟人脑的学习过程。

  • 卷积神经网络(CNN):主要用于图像识别和处理,例如医学影像分析和自动驾驶。
  • 循环神经网络(RNN):适用于序列数据处理,例如自然语言处理和时间序列预测。
  • 生成对抗网络(GAN):用于生成逼真的数据,例如图像生成和语音合成。

3. 自然语言处理(NLP)

NLP技术使计算机能够理解和生成人类语言。

  • 文本分类:将文本归类到预定义的类别中,例如情感分析和垃圾邮件检测。
  • 实体识别:从文本中提取命名实体,例如人名、地名和组织名。
  • 机器翻译:将一种语言翻译为另一种语言,例如Google Translate。

4. 计算机视觉

计算机视觉技术使计算机能够理解和分析图像和视频。

  • 目标检测:识别图像中的目标并标注位置,例如人脸识别和自动驾驶中的障碍物检测。
  • 图像分割:将图像划分为多个区域,例如医学图像分割和场景理解。
  • 图像生成:通过GAN等技术生成新的图像,例如风格迁移和图像修复。

二、AI分析技术的实现方法

AI分析技术的实现涉及多个步骤,从数据准备到模型部署,每个环节都需要精心设计和优化。

1. 数据准备

数据是AI分析的基础,高质量的数据是模型准确性的关键。

  • 数据清洗:去除噪声数据和重复数据,例如处理缺失值和异常值。
  • 数据转换:将数据转换为适合模型的形式,例如归一化和标准化。
  • 数据增强:通过增加数据的多样性和复杂性来提升模型的泛化能力,例如图像旋转和裁剪。

2. 特征工程

特征工程是将原始数据转换为对模型友好的特征的过程。

  • 特征选择:从大量特征中选择对目标变量影响最大的特征,例如使用统计方法和模型评估指标。
  • 特征提取:通过降维技术提取数据的高层次特征,例如主成分分析(PCA)和t-SNE。
  • 特征构建:根据业务需求构建新的特征,例如时间特征和交互特征。

3. 模型训练

模型训练是通过优化算法调整模型参数,使其在训练数据上表现最佳。

  • 选择模型:根据问题类型选择合适的模型,例如线性回归用于回归任务,随机森林用于分类任务。
  • 优化参数:通过网格搜索和随机搜索找到最优模型参数。
  • 交叉验证:通过交叉验证评估模型的泛化能力,例如k折交叉验证。

4. 模型调优

模型调优是通过优化模型结构和参数进一步提升模型性能。

  • 超参数调优:通过自动化的超参数调优工具(如GridSearch和RandomizedSearch)找到最优超参数。
  • 集成学习:通过集成多个模型的结果提升模型性能,例如随机森林和梯度提升树。
  • 模型解释性:通过可解释性技术(如SHAP和LIME)解释模型的决策过程。

5. 模型部署

模型部署是将训练好的模型应用于实际场景的过程。

  • API接口:将模型封装为API,供其他系统调用,例如RESTful API。
  • 实时预测:通过流数据处理技术实现实时预测,例如Apache Kafka和Flink。
  • 模型监控:通过监控工具实时监控模型性能,例如A/B测试和漂移检测。

三、AI分析技术的应用场景

AI分析技术已经在多个领域得到了广泛应用,以下是几个典型场景:

1. 数据中台

数据中台是企业级的数据中枢,通过整合和分析多源数据,为企业提供统一的数据视图。

  • 数据整合:通过数据中台整合结构化、半结构化和非结构化数据,例如ERP系统和社交媒体数据。
  • 数据建模:通过数据中台构建数据模型,例如客户画像和产品画像。
  • 数据服务:通过数据中台提供数据服务,例如实时数据查询和历史数据分析。

2. 数字孪生

数字孪生是通过数字技术创建物理世界的虚拟模型,用于模拟和优化现实世界。

  • 模型构建:通过3D建模和仿真技术构建虚拟模型,例如城市规划和建筑设计。
  • 数据驱动:通过实时数据更新虚拟模型,例如物联网设备数据和传感器数据。
  • 决策支持:通过数字孪生提供决策支持,例如预测维护和应急响应。

3. 数字可视化

数字可视化是通过可视化技术将数据转化为易于理解的图表和图形。

  • 数据可视化:通过可视化工具(如Tableau和Power BI)将数据转化为图表,例如柱状图、折线图和散点图。
  • 交互式可视化:通过交互式可视化技术实现用户与数据的互动,例如仪表盘和地图可视化。
  • 动态更新:通过实时数据更新可视化内容,例如股票价格实时监控和交通流量实时显示。

四、AI分析技术的挑战与解决方案

尽管AI分析技术具有诸多优势,但在实际应用中仍面临一些挑战。

1. 数据质量

数据质量是AI分析技术的核心,低质量的数据会导致模型性能下降。

  • 数据清洗:通过数据清洗技术去除噪声数据和重复数据。
  • 数据增强:通过数据增强技术增加数据的多样性和复杂性。
  • 数据标注:通过人工标注技术提升数据的准确性。

2. 模型解释性

模型解释性是AI分析技术的重要指标,黑箱模型难以被业务人员理解和信任。

  • 可解释性技术:通过可解释性技术(如SHAP和LIME)解释模型的决策过程。
  • 可视化工具:通过可视化工具(如LIME和SHAP)展示模型的解释性。
  • 模型简化:通过简化模型结构提升模型的可解释性,例如线性回归和决策树。

3. 计算资源

计算资源是AI分析技术的瓶颈,大规模数据和复杂模型需要强大的计算能力。

  • 分布式计算:通过分布式计算技术(如Spark和Hadoop)处理大规模数据。
  • 云计算:通过云计算技术(如AWS和Azure)提供弹性计算资源。
  • 边缘计算:通过边缘计算技术(如Edge AI)实现本地计算和数据处理。

4. 模型更新

模型更新是AI分析技术的持续过程,模型需要定期更新以适应数据变化。

  • 自动化更新:通过自动化更新技术(如A/B测试和模型监控)实现模型的自动更新。
  • 持续学习:通过持续学习技术(如在线学习和迁移学习)实现模型的持续优化。
  • 模型复用:通过模型复用技术(如模型微调和模型压缩)实现模型的快速复用。

五、AI分析技术的未来趋势

随着技术的不断发展,AI分析技术将朝着以下几个方向发展:

1. 边缘计算

边缘计算将AI分析技术推向边缘端,实现本地计算和数据处理。

  • 实时性:通过边缘计算技术实现数据的实时处理和分析。
  • 隐私性:通过边缘计算技术保护数据的隐私和安全。
  • 可靠性:通过边缘计算技术实现系统的高可靠性和容错性。

2. 多模态融合

多模态融合技术将多种数据类型(如文本、图像和语音)融合在一起,提升模型的综合能力。

  • 跨模态理解:通过多模态融合技术实现跨模态的理解和分析,例如图像和文本的联合分析。
  • 联合学习:通过联合学习技术(如多模态学习和跨模态学习)实现数据的联合分析。
  • 统一模型:通过统一模型(如视觉-语言模型)实现多种数据类型的统一分析。

3. 自动化机器学习

自动化机器学习技术将机器学习过程自动化,降低技术门槛。

  • 自动数据处理:通过自动化数据处理技术(如AutoML)实现数据的自动清洗和特征工程。
  • 自动模型选择:通过自动化模型选择技术(如AutoML)实现模型的自动选择和优化。
  • 自动模型部署:通过自动化模型部署技术(如AutoML)实现模型的自动部署和监控。

4. 可持续AI

可持续AI技术将环保理念融入AI分析技术,减少对环境的影响。

  • 绿色计算:通过绿色计算技术(如能源-efficient硬件和算法优化)减少计算资源的消耗。
  • 数据节俭:通过数据节俭技术(如数据增强和数据合成)减少对数据的需求。
  • 碳中和:通过碳中和技术(如碳抵消和碳补偿)实现AI分析技术的碳中和。

六、申请试用 & https://www.dtstack.com/?src=bbs

如果您对AI分析技术感兴趣,或者希望了解如何在实际中应用这些技术,可以申请试用相关工具和服务。通过实践,您可以更好地理解AI分析技术的核心算法与实现方法,并将其应用于实际业务中。

申请试用


七、结语

AI分析技术正在改变我们的生活方式和工作方式,通过不断的技术创新和应用实践,我们可以更好地利用数据驱动决策,提升企业的竞争力和创新能力。希望本文能够为您提供有价值的 insights,并激发您对AI分析技术的兴趣和探索。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料